Is Golden, CO Safe?
Golden, CO is a safe city with a safety score of 76/100, placing it safer than 41% of US cities. The city ranks #5,266 out of 8,874 US cities in our safety database.
The violent crime rate of 123.8 per 100k is 67% below the national average (380 per 100k). Violent crime accounts for 5% of all reported incidents.
This city is generally suitable for families, retirees, and visitors.
